Artists Q&A series
Here at Art Ink Print, we are always looking for ways to build community among artists, by helping them with marketing advice and sponsoring local art events.
We had an idea to ask some of the artists we print for a series of questions, to help inspire readers on our site to embark on or develop their art career and also help raise the profile of the Artists who have taken part in our Q&A.
We hope you enjoy reading the stories of our clients who kindly agreed to be involved!
